Key Insights

The global perfluorosulfonic acid (PFSA) market is experiencing robust growth, driven primarily by the increasing demand for fuel cells in transportation and stationary power applications. The rising adoption of electric vehicles (EVs) and the push for renewable energy sources are significant catalysts. PFSA resins, in both dispersion and granule forms, are crucial components in fuel cell membranes and electrodes, enhancing their performance and durability. The market is segmented by application, with fuel cell membranes holding the largest share due to their critical role in proton exchange membrane fuel cells (PEMFCs). Other applications, such as ion exchange conductive films and catalysts in various industries, are also contributing to market expansion. While the exact market size for 2025 is not specified, considering a conservative estimate for the CAGR and the provided data, we can reasonably project a market value in the range of $1.5 - $2 billion for 2025. This figure is supported by the presence of major players like Solvay and DuPont, indicating significant investment and market penetration. Regional analysis suggests a strong presence in North America and Europe, owing to established manufacturing facilities and technological advancements in these regions; however, the Asia-Pacific region is anticipated to exhibit higher growth rates in the coming years due to increasing industrialization and government initiatives promoting clean energy adoption.

Market restraints include the high cost of PFSA materials, concerns regarding their environmental impact, and the ongoing research and development efforts focused on finding alternative materials with similar performance characteristics but improved sustainability profiles. However, technological advancements in PFSA synthesis and manufacturing are expected to mitigate these challenges to some extent. The forecast period (2025-2033) anticipates sustained growth, fueled by the continuing expansion of the fuel cell market and the broader shift toward cleaner energy solutions. The competitive landscape is moderately consolidated, with key players constantly investing in research and development to enhance product features and expand their market share. This creates a dynamic market that balances innovation with established industrial dominance, resulting in sustained but carefully monitored expansion.

Driving Forces: What's Propelling the Perfluorosulfonic Acid (PFSA) Market?

The surging demand for fuel cells is the primary driver of the PFSA market's expansion. The increasing adoption of electric vehicles (EVs) globally is a major factor. PFSAs are crucial components in fuel cell membranes, and as the EV market continues its exponential growth, the demand for high-performance PFSAs is correspondingly escalating. Furthermore, the global shift towards renewable energy sources and the need for efficient energy storage solutions are fueling the demand for fuel cells in stationary power generation applications, further stimulating the PFSA market. Beyond fuel cells, the use of PFSAs in other applications, such as ion-exchange membranes for water purification and various industrial catalysts, contributes significantly to market growth. The increasing awareness of water scarcity and the stringent environmental regulations are driving the adoption of advanced water purification technologies, which heavily rely on PFSA-based membranes. Similarly, the chemical industry's constant pursuit of efficient and environmentally friendly catalysts enhances the demand for PFSAs. Government initiatives promoting clean energy and sustainable technologies are also encouraging the growth of the PFSA market. Financial incentives and supportive policies focused on transitioning to cleaner energy sources are creating a favorable environment for the broader adoption of fuel cell technology and thus PFSA-based materials.

Challenges and Restraints in Perfluorosulfonic Acid (PFSA) Market

Despite the positive outlook, the PFSA market faces several challenges. The high cost of production remains a major barrier to wider adoption, particularly in price-sensitive applications. The complex manufacturing process and the use of expensive raw materials contribute to the high cost. Moreover, environmental concerns related to the potential toxicity and persistence of PFSAs are a significant concern. Stringent environmental regulations and growing public awareness of the environmental impact of PFASs are pushing for the development of more sustainable alternatives. This necessitates substantial investment in research and development to discover and develop environmentally friendly alternatives or to find methods to mitigate the environmental impact of PFSAs. Competition from emerging technologies, such as alkaline fuel cells and other membrane materials, also poses a threat to the PFSA market. These alternative technologies offer potential cost advantages or enhanced performance characteristics, thereby creating pressure on PFSA manufacturers to innovate and improve their products. Finally, fluctuations in the price of raw materials used in PFSA production can impact profitability and market stability. Careful supply chain management and strategic sourcing strategies are crucial for mitigating these risks.

Key Region or Country & Segment to Dominate the Market

The fuel cell membrane segment is projected to dominate the PFSA market throughout the forecast period. This is primarily due to the rapid expansion of the fuel cell industry, driven by increasing demand for electric vehicles and stationary power generation. The rising adoption of fuel cell electric vehicles (FCEVs) and the growing interest in hydrogen-based energy infrastructure are key factors driving the demand for high-performance PFSA membranes. The segment's growth is fueled by advancements in membrane technology, leading to improved durability, efficiency, and cost-effectiveness. Manufacturers are continuously investing in R&D to enhance membrane properties, such as thermal stability and chemical resistance, to meet the rigorous demands of various fuel cell applications.

  • North America: Holds a significant market share due to the high adoption of fuel cell technologies in transportation and energy sectors. Government support for clean energy initiatives and the presence of major PFSA manufacturers contribute to the region's dominance.

  • Asia-Pacific: Shows the fastest growth rate, driven by the rapid expansion of the electric vehicle market in China, Japan, and South Korea. The region's increasing investment in renewable energy infrastructure also boosts the demand for PFSAs.

  • Europe: Displays steady growth, driven by supportive government policies promoting clean energy technologies. However, stringent environmental regulations present both challenges and opportunities, pushing the development of more sustainable and less toxic PFSA-based products.

The perfluorosulfonic acid resin dispersion type is gaining traction owing to its ease of processing and suitability for various applications. This type offers flexibility in terms of application methods and allows for better integration into different fuel cell components and other applications.
